Improvements in Robotics



One major innovation in oral surgery is the use of robot modern technology, which allows for specific and reliable surgical procedures. With the help of robotic systems, oral doctors have the capability to do complex surgeries with enhanced accuracy, decreasing the risk of human error.



These robotic systems are geared up with advanced imaging technology and specific tools that enable specialists to browse through complex physiological structures effortlessly. By making use of robot modern technology, doctors can achieve higher medical accuracy, resulting in enhanced individual results and faster recuperation times.

Furthermore, using robotics in oral surgery enables minimally invasive treatments, minimizing the trauma to surrounding tissues and promoting faster recovery.

Minimally Intrusive Techniques



To additionally advance the area of dental surgery, welcome the possibility of minimally invasive methods that can greatly benefit both specialists and individuals alike.

Minimally intrusive techniques are changing the field by decreasing medical injury, decreasing post-operative pain, and accelerating the recuperation procedure. These techniques involve utilizing smaller lacerations and specialized instruments to do treatments with accuracy and performance.

By using innovative imaging technology, such as cone beam of light computed tomography (CBCT), cosmetic surgeons can precisely prepare and perform surgical treatments with marginal invasiveness.

Furthermore, making use of lasers in dental surgery allows for exact tissue cutting and coagulation, resulting in lessened blood loss and reduced recovery time.

With minimally intrusive strategies, patients can experience faster healing, reduced scarring, and improved end results, making it a vital aspect of the future of oral surgery.
